Advanced Practice Registered Nurses (APRNs) often play a crucial role as primary care providers, delivering preventative care services to the public. The APRN title is not limited to one role; it encompasses a range of professions such as nurse practitioners, nurse anesthetists, clinical nurse specialists, and nurse midwives.
